Responsibilities:
Assist in set-up of equipment accurately and in accordance with proper and safe setup techniques. Inspect before and after running to ensure that any necessary repairs are made before next run. Minimize material sheet, label, and adhesive waste. Maximize the utilization of equipment by operating the machinery at available capacity and speed. Complete daily and weekly equipment clean-ups. Perform continuous quality control: select material at random to check size, material, print and glue. Abide by all company policies and procedures, including practicing safe work habits. Communicate effectively and professionally in all forms of communication. Maintain regular attendance as required by your position.
Qualifications:
High school diploma or GED required. Prior laminating or experience working with adhesives a plus. Strong ability to read a ruler and understand fractions. Corrugated industry experience preferred. Previous mechanical or manufacturing experience preferred.
